POKAHARA, Nepal (AP) — A spokesman for Nepal’s civil aviation authority says the flight information recorder and cockpit voice recorder had been taken off the crash website of a passenger jet because it approached a newly opened airport within the vacationer space. Pokhara metropolis.
Jagannath Neeraula stated the bins had been discovered on Monday, a day after the ATR-72 airplane crashed, killing 68 of the 72 folks on board. They stated they are going to be handed over to investigators.
Yeti Airways spokesperson Pemba Sherpam confirmed the restoration of flight information and cockpit voice recorders.
Nepal has began a nationwide day of mourning as rescue staff scaled a 300m (984ft) cliff to proceed the search. Two extra our bodies had been discovered Monday morning.
The reason for the crash, the worst airplane crash within the Himalayan nation in three many years, remains to be unclear. On the day of the accident, the climate was delicate and there was no wind.

Nepal’s civil aviation authority stated the airplane had final touched down on the airport close to Seti Gorge at 10:50 a.m. earlier than the crash.
The dual-engine ATR 72, operated by Nepal’s Yeti Airways, was competing on a 27-minute flight to Pokhara, about 200 kilometers (120 miles) west of the capital, Kathmandu. In response to an announcement issued by the Nepal Civil Aviation Authority, there have been 68 passengers, together with 15 foreigners, and 4 crew members. Overseas nationals embody 5 Indians, 4 Russians, two South Koreans and one every from Eire, Australia, Argentina and France.

Pokhara is the gateway to the Annapurna circuit, a preferred trek within the Himalayas. Town’s new worldwide airport grew to become operational solely two weeks in the past.
The plane sort concerned, the ATR 72, is utilized by airways world wide for brief regional flights. The plane mannequin, which was launched within the late Nineteen Eighties by a partnership between France and Italy, has induced a number of deadly accidents over time.

ATR recognized the plane concerned in Sunday’s crash as an ATR 72-500 on Twitter. Plane monitoring information from flightradar24.com confirmed the airplane was 15 years outdated and “geared up with an outdated transponder with unreliable information”. Earlier than being seized in 2019, the Yeti was beforehand flown by India’s Kingfisher Airways and Thailand’s Nok Air, in keeping with data on Airfleet.web.
Yeti Airways has six ATR 72-500 plane, firm spokesperson Sudarshan Bartula stated.
Residence to eight of the world’s 14 highest mountains, together with Mount Everest, Nepal has a historical past of air disasters. Sunday’s catastrophe was the worst in Nepal since 1992, when a Pakistan Worldwide Airways airplane crashed right into a hill whereas attempting to land in Kathmandu, killing 167 folks.
In response to the Aviation Security Basis’s Aviation Security Database, there have been 42 deadly airplane crashes in Nepal since 1946.
In response to a 2019 security report from the Nepal Civil Aviation Authority, the nation’s “hostile topography” and “numerous climate situations” are the largest dangers to flights within the nation. Accidents just like the one within the report happen at airports with brief runways for takeoff and touchdown, and most are as a result of pilot error.
Within the yr Between 2009 and 2018, 37% of air accidents in Nepal had been attributable to plane pilots, not helicopters and leisure flights, the report added.
The European Union has banned airways from Nepal from flying to 27 nations since 2013, citing poor security requirements. Within the yr In 2017, the Worldwide Civil Aviation Group famous enhancements in Nepal’s aviation sector, however the European Union continued to demand administrative reforms.
